River Trail is an extremely easy picturesque trail, especially popular and often visited by families with kids and various age visitors, who are eager to enjoy all the beauty of Smith Rock State Park without climbing the strenuous trails, preferring a pleasant saunter at a leisurely pace.

To find to the River Trail from the parking you need to go down to the Crooked River by The Chute trail, which is quite steep, or by the Canyon Trail, which is longer, but more level and smooth. After crossing the wooden footbridge across the river you should take the left turn to start the River Trail (if you turn right you’ll find the Wolf Tree Trail, and going strait is the Misery Ridge Trail).

And here your Smith Rock adventure will start. Having the sparkling Crooked River twisting through the canyon on your left and beautiful huge rocks and stone walls, consisting mostly of Smith Rock tuff and basalt on your left, don’t forget to keep your eyes wide open not to miss anything.

The first famous climbing spot which you will pass following the River Trail is the Picnic Lunch Wall. Going further you will approach the main area for climbers with many shorter and more narrow trails going to the right from the River Trail and leading to the main climbing destinations such as Christian Brothers, Morning Glory Wall and others.

Do not miss an Asterisk Pass, a huge rock resembling a Snoopy Head, and after it the Smith Rock Group.
Proceeding your stroll along the trail you may see not just water fowl, but also some wild animals, like deer, otters or beavers.

Soon you will see the connection of the River Trail and the Mesa Verde Trail which will give you more options for further explorations of Smith Rock State Park.
